Please select your home edition
Edition
Trofeo Princesa Sofía Mallorca 2025

2023 International Masters Regatta

© Mark Albertazzi
2023 International Masters Regatta photo copyright Mark Albertazzi taken at San Diego Yacht Club and featuring the J105 class
J105San Diego Yacht Club
RS Sailing 2021 - FOOTERTrofeo Princesa Sofía Mallorca 2025Rooster 2025